Rs 89,155 crore has been allocated for the health sector in the Union Budget 2023-24, which is about 13 per cent higher than the amount of Rs 79,145 crore allocated in 2022-23. Along with this, a mission has also been announced to eradicate the disease called ‘Sickle Cell Anemia’ by 2047. Sickle cell is a genetic disease.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Wednesday presented the Union Budget for 2023-24 and said 157 new nursing colleges will be set up in addition to the existing 157 medical colleges established since 2014.

A mission will be launched to eliminate ‘sickle cell anemia’ by 2047, he said. It will provide awareness generation, universal screening of seven crore people in the age group of 0-40 years in the affected tribal areas, and counseling through the efforts of Central Ministries and State Governments. The Finance Minister said that encouraging collaborative research and innovation Faculty members from public and private medical colleges and private sector R&D team will be provided facilities for research in selected laboratories of the Indian Council of Medical Research (ICMR).

The budget allocation for the Ministry of AYUSH has been increased from Rs 2,845.75 crore to Rs 3,647.50 crore, an increase of 28 per cent. Of the Rs 89,155 crore allocated in the budget, Rs 86,175 crore has been allocated to the Department of Health and Family Welfare, while Rs 2,980 crore has been allocated to the Department of Health Research. From the new financial year, the Pradhan Mantri Swasthya Suraksha Yojana (PMSSY) has been divided into two sub-schemes.

The first is the PMSSY itself and the second is the expenditure related to setting up 22 new All India Institutes of Medical Sciences (AIIMS), for which Rs 6,835 crore has been allocated. The budget allocation for the Pradhan Mantri Swasthya Suraksha Yojana for the year 2023-2024 is Rs 3,365 crore. Among these central sector schemes, the budget allocation for the National Health Mission has been increased from Rs 28,974.29 crore in 2022-23 to Rs 29,085.26 crore in 2023-24, and for the Pradhan Mantri Jan Arogya Yojana (PM-JAY) from Rs 6,412 crore 7,200 crore has been increased from Rs.

The allocation for the National Digital Health Mission-NHM has been increased from Rs 140 crore to Rs 341.02 crore. The budget allocation for the National Tele Mental Health Program has been increased from Rs 121 crore to Rs 133.73 crore. The budget allocation for autonomous bodies has been increased from Rs 10,348.17 crore in 2022-23 to Rs 17,322.55 crore in 2023-24. Among autonomous bodies, the allocation for the New Delhi-based All India Institute of Medical Sciences (AIIMS) has been reduced from Rs 4,400.24 crore to Rs 4,134.67 crore. The allocation for ICMR has been increased from Rs 2,116.73 crore to Rs 2,359.58 crore.
